n. A nightclub that features dancing to recorded or sometimes live music and often has showy decor and elaborate lighting. [French, record library, discothèque, from Italian discoteca, record library : disco, disk, record (from Latin discus, quoit; see DISCUS) + biblioteca, library (from Latin bibliothēca; see BIBLIOTHECA).] |
